Generally, the Nucleus is the central and most important part of an object, movement, or group, forming the basis for its activity and growth.
In Physics, the Nucleus is the positively charged central core of an atom, consisting of protons and neutrons and containing nearly all its mass.
In Biology, the Nucleus is a dense organelle present in most eukaryotic cells, typically a single rounded structure bounded by a double membrane, containing the genetic material.
